Job Overview:
As the Procurement/Purchse, you will be responsible for overseeing all procurement activities across the organization. You will develop and implement procurement strategies to optimize cost, quality, and delivery of goods and services while ensuring compliance with company policies and regulatory requirements. Your role will involve managing vendor relationships, negotiating contracts, and driving continuous improvement initiatives within the procurement function.
Key Responsibilities:
Develop and implement procurement strategies aligned with the company's objectives and budgetary constraints.
Lead the procurement team in sourcing, evaluating, and selecting suppliers/vendors based on quality, cost, and delivery performance.
Negotiate favorable terms and conditions with suppliers/vendors to secure competitive pricing, favorable payment terms, and service level agreements.
Establish and maintain strong vendor relationships to ensure timely delivery of goods and services and resolve any issues or disputes that may arise.
Monitor market trends, supplier performance, and industry best practices to identify opportunities for cost savings, process improvements, and innovation.
Collaborate with internal stakeholders, including finance, operations, and legal departments, to ensure alignment of procurement activities with business objectives and regulatory requirements.
Develop and maintain procurement policies, procedures, and documentation to ensure compliance with internal controls and external regulations
Lead and mentor the procurement team, providing guidance, training, and performance feedback to foster professional development and achieve departmental goals.
Evaluate and implement procurement technologies and systems to streamline processes, enhance transparency, and improve efficiency in procurement operations.
Prepare and present procurement reports, budgets, and performance metrics to senior management to support decision-making and strategic planning initiatives.
